Abstract

The utility model relates to the technical field of waste treatment and discloses a waste treatment device in a biological laboratory, which comprises a base and a ball seat, wherein an annular sliding rail is arranged at the top of the base, treatment boxes are fixedly connected to two sides of the top of the ball seat, the bottom of the ball seat is slidably connected to the inside of the annular sliding rail, a stand is fixedly connected to the middle of the base, a servo motor is fixedly connected to the bottom of the inner wall of the stand, a vertical rod is fixedly connected to the driving end of the servo motor, a first bevel gear is fixedly connected to the outer wall of the vertical rod, and a driving gear is fixedly connected to the bottom end of the vertical rod. According to the utility model, the servo motor drives the driving gear to rotate, the driven gear rotates along with the driving gear, and the position rotation of the two side treatment boxes can be realized under the cooperation of the ball seat and the annular sliding rail, so that the experimenters can conveniently prevent different kinds of experimental wastes, the technical effect of classified collection is realized, and the technical purpose of convenient use is achieved.

Background
The biological laboratory is classified according to different study objects for study and research, is divided into four grades altogether, is also called as biological safety protection laboratory, and can avoid or control the harm of operated harmful biological factors through protection barriers and management measures, and waste is inevitably generated in the experimental process, so that a waste treatment device is needed.
Waste treatment device for biological laboratory among the prior art can not carry out classification collection to stronger material of corrosivity and ordinary material, and the discarded object can produce comparatively foul smell at the handling process, influences the user and uses processing apparatus, consequently, this application provides a biological laboratory waste treatment device.
